The Role of Symbol Design in Player Psychology

Symbols are not mere decorative elements; they are carefully crafted tools that communicate themes, evoke emotions, and often subtly guide player attention. Industry analyses reveal that visual cues can significantly impact a player’s perceived experience and their subsequent gameplay choices. For example, symbols colored in vibrant hues like pink, cyan, orange, and green tend to stand out on the reels, stimulating visual interest and potentially prolonging engagement.

Visual Symbolism: Beyond Aesthetics

Colour Significance & Impact
Pink Associated with excitement and novelty, pink symbols can evoke feelings of joy and curiosity, often used for special bonus symbols or high-value icons.
Cyan Conveys freshness and modernity. Cyan elements are less aggressive than red but still vibrant—used in thematic accents to provide visual balance.
Orange Symbolises energy and enthusiasm, often used to highlight winning symbols or triggers for bonus rounds, encouraging players to keep spinning.
Green Linked to luck and prosperity, green symbols typically denote prosperity or free spin opportunities, aligning with the player’s goals of winning.

Integrating Symbol Visuals with Game Mechanics

Effective symbol design isn’t solely about aesthetics; it links directly to game mechanics and payout structures. For instance, the introduction of multi-coloured wilds with dynamic animations enhances the perception of fairness and excitement—key factors in player satisfaction. Studies within the industry demonstrate that such thoughtful design fosters increased RTP (Return to Player) expectations and retention rates.
